This method returns a type-specific bidirectional iterator with given
starting point. The starting point is any element comparable to the
elements of this set (even if it does not actually belong to the set).
The next element of the returned iterator is the least element of the set
that is greater than the starting point (if there are no elements greater
than the starting point,
hasNext()
will return false). The previous element of the returned iterator
is the greatest element of the set that is smaller than or equal to the
starting point (if there are no elements smaller than or equal to the
starting point,
hasPrevious() will return false).
Note that passing the last element of the set as starting point and
calling previous() you can traverse the entire set in reverse order.
